Ian Brand is one of the Central Coast's most curious winemakers, and this bottling pulls fruit from older Cabernet plantings in a region better known for everyday wine than serious red. In his hands, it becomes something else: medium bodied, savory, herbal edged, with cassis and dried sage and a real sense of place. The opposite of glossy
